MMEX's "off-take agreement" can't be verified, and it is nonsensical. PT has no use for straight-run diesel - no one but another refiner would have use for it. In order for PT to use straight-run diesel (AGO), which contains sulphur above 3ppm, it would have to obtain separate tankers, segregated storage, and segregated load/off-load systems due to sulphur contamination - ULSD can't be mixed with straight-run diesel.

Further, there is no customer that could make use of it, other than in the highly limited, and declining HOBM application.
